The Society of Actuaries (SOA) Exam SRM (Statistics for Risk Modeling) is a 3.5-hour exam that tests your ability to apply statistical methods and modeling techniques to real-world risk scenarios. It's required for anyone pursuing the ASA (Associate) or FSA (Fellow) credential in actuarial science, and it combines probability, statistical inference, and predictive modeling into one comprehensive assessment.
SRM challenges students primarily in three areas: mastering the breadth of statistical concepts (from hypothesis testing to regression modeling), managing time effectively across 35-40 multiple-choice questions, and applying theoretical knowledge to unfamiliar, scenario-based problems. Many students struggle with distinguishing between when to use different statistical methods and interpreting output from statistical software in the context of risk modeling.
Most candidates benefit from 3-4 months of focused preparation, dedicating 10-15 hours per week to studying. This timeline allows you to work through foundational concepts, complete practice problems, take full-length practice exams, and identify weak areas for targeted review. Starting earlier gives you more flexibility to deepen your understanding of challenging topics like generalized linear models and Bayesian methods.
Practice tests reveal exactly where you stand on exam-day pacing and question comprehension—two critical factors that separate passing from failing scores. By taking multiple full-length practice exams under timed conditions, you'll identify which statistical concepts need deeper study, learn to recognize question patterns, and build the confidence and stamina needed for the actual 3.5-hour exam.
Start by taking a diagnostic practice exam or working through sample problems from each major topic (probability, statistical inference, regression, predictive modeling) to pinpoint where you're losing points. Once you've identified weak areas, focus your study time there with targeted problem sets and concept reviews before moving back to full-length practice exams. Effective SRM strategies include: reading each question carefully to identify what's being asked before diving into calculations, managing your time by flagging difficult questions and returning to them later, and using the provided formulas and tables efficiently. Practice timed exams to develop a rhythm—typically spending 5-6 minutes per question—and build confidence in your ability to work through unfamiliar scenarios under pressure.
